How much does it cost to repair a rock hit windshield?
Costs for windshield repairs vary by location, auto glass service provider and damage type. Typical prices range from $60 to $100 for a single chip, and discounts may apply when fixing additional chips on the same windshield. Crack repair prices are similar, although fixing a longer crack may cost $125 or more.
Are windshields ever covered under warranty?
While windshield replacements may be covered by auto insurance policies, most extended warranties and vehicle service contracts typically exclude coverage for windshields. If your windshield sustains damage that is not covered by your insurance, you will need to seek assistance from a windshield specialist for repairs.
Should I still see a crack after Safelite repair?
Can you guarantee that the chip or crack will be invisible after the windshield repair has been completed? No. A windshield chip or crack repair is used to prevent further damage to your glass and to restore the structural integrity of the vehicle.
Does a cracked windshield count as a claim?
If your windshield gets chipped or cracked, you should file a comprehensive claim as soon as you can and before you proceed with repairs. Important note: You shouldn't wait too long after the damage occurs to file a glass claim, and the claim should be filed before any repairs take place.

How long does Safelite warranty last?
lifetime warranty
Safelite's nationwide lifetime warranty covers its glass replacement service against defects in material and/or workmanship for as long as you own or lease the vehicle. You must notify us within 30 days of discovering the defect.
Will insurance pay for windshield replacement?
Comprehensive coverage on a car insurance policy may help pay to repair or replace your windshield if it's cracked or shattered by a rock. Another coverage, called full glass coverage, may also be available to help protect you against the cost of fixing or replacing a windshield.
